WVU Football 2027 OL Recruit Stafford Willis Raves About Junior Day Visit
An offensive line recruit raves about his experience at the WVU football Junior Day over the weekend.
After returning home to Alabama, 2027 prospect Stafford Willis offered his thoughts about his time in West Virginia on social media.
“Incredible weekend at the WVU football 2027 Elite Day was top notch – great conversations with the coaches, learned a lot about the programโs vision, and canโt wait to be back this spring. Thank you,” said Willis on X (formerly Twitter).ย
A 6-foot-5 and 280-pound offensive tackle out of Arab High School, Willis is a team captain for his high school team.
Willis has been a focus of the West Virginia staff in recent week, which included paying him a visit in late January.
“It was a great visit- learned a lot more about the WVU program, very impressive facilities and looking forward to going back in the spring! From their weight room and trainers to the locker room and the academic staff, everything was top notch,” said Willis about what the WVU program has to offer.
Prior to his time with WVU’s Derek Dressler, Arkansas sent someone to check in with Willis. In addition to those Power Four schools, Willis has offers from Liberty, Tulane and Cornell.
